Zusammenfassung:Because of the difficulties of studying complex phenomena in higher plants such as tobacco, we want to develop Arabidopsis thaliana as a model system for studying the hypersensitive response. As a first step toward using A. thaliana as a model system and also helping to determine the function of PR-1 proteins, PR-1 like genes from Arabidopsis were isolated. A tobacco PR-1b cDNA clone was used as a probe to isolate two genomic clones from Arabidopsis . Although both clones hybridize to the tobacco PR-1 genes, they do not cross-hybridize with each other, suggesting that there is extensive sequence diversity between the two genes.
